Computer Science/Discrete Mathematics :: 이산수학

이산수학 2강 :: 명제, 논리연산, 술어논리

HJPlumtree 2022. 3. 15. 10:18

이산수학 2강을 보며 배운내용

 

 

명제 (Proposition)

참과 거짓을 구별할 수 있는 문장이나 수학적 식

정확하게 참인지 거짓인지 판별할 수 있어야된다

 

명제의 진리값(truth value)

참이나 거짓

 

 

논리 연산

논리집합과 논리 연산으로 나타낸 것

 

논리집합

논리상수(T, F), 논리변수(명제)

 

논리연산

or, and, not, xor

 

합성명제

논리연산자로 만든 명제

 

추가로

  • 조건 명제
  • 쌍조건 명제
  • 논리적 동치
  • 항진명제
  • 모순명제

 

명제의 진리표는 약속이라 외워야한다

=> 명제 논리 나무위키 링크

 

 

술어논리(Predicate Logic)

명제함수(미지수 포함된 것)를 술어논리라고 한다

x + 1 = 4

x 값에 따라 진리값이 참 혹은 거짓이 될 수 있다

 

한정화(quantification)

  • 전체 한정자 ∀: 모든수 or 임의수를 나타낼 때 사용
  • 존재 한정자 ∃: 어떤 x에 대한 것만 따지는 것

 

 

벤 다이어그램(Venn Diagram)

한정자가 사용된 명제함수의 타당성을 직관적으로 검사